TNT Sports (formerly BT Sport) is a group of pay television sports channels in the United Kingdom and Ireland. Owned by Warner Bros. Discovery Sports Europe and BT Group, they first launched on 1 August 2013. The channels are based at Warner Bros. Discovery's complex in Chiswick Business Park, London, having been based at Here East, the former ...

In 2015, BT Group reached a long-term deal with ESPN International to continue holding British rights to ESPN-owned sports rights and original programmes. This resulted in many of ESPN's signature sports shows, such as College GameDay and Baseball Tonight, being shown on BT Sport ESPN.
